We say that an integer a is a type 0 integer if there exists an integer n such that a = 3n. An integer a is a type 1 integer if there exists an integer n such that a = 3n + 1. An integer a is a type 2 integer if there exists an integer n such that a = 3n + 2. Prove that if a is a type 1 integer, then a 2 is a type 1 integer\
